Repair Process
Every PARKER R4VP1XX-0P3P0PM10VA130 gets a controlled teardown on our bench. We document condition, replace what’s needed, and reassemble to proper operating condition.
- Teardown: Every valve is disassembled for internal inspection.
- In-House Parts Sourcing: Many repairs use components sourced from our inventory of 17,000+ units.
- Seal and Gasket Replacement: Worn seals and gaskets are replaced with new components during every rebuild.
- Final Performance Verification: After reassembly, each valve is bench-tested against published performance specifications.
Diagnostic Testing
NC Servo Tech operates over a dozen dedicated flow test stands, including setups for proportional and servo valves. Every valve goes through performance and leak testing using standard test fluids to match your operational needs. Our pre-shipment testing verifies proper functionality.

Maintenance Tips
- Inspect PARKER R4VP1XX-0P3P0PM10VA130 seals regularly to prevent leaks and maintain performance.
- Schedule preventive maintenance intervals based on duty cycle, not just calendar time.
- Perform fluid analysis to detect contamination early and prevent system damage.
